#4dba47 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4dba47 is composed of 30.2% red, 72.9%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.8%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 116.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 50.4%. #4dba47 color hex could be obtained by blending #9aff8e with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#4dba47 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4dba47 has RGB values of R:77, G:186,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5093959.

Shades and Tints of #4dba47
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3faf2 is the lightest one.
